What type of buying decision making is used when purchasing Dress pants and shirt? *

Business

The type of decision making used when purchasing dress, pants and shirt is <u>routine decision making</u>.

<u>Explanation</u>:

Depending upon the involvement shown in buying the products, the type of buying decision making can be categorized as:

• Routine response behavior

• Limited decision making

• Extensive decision making.

<u>Routine response behavior </u>is exposed when the consumer is familiar with the product to-be-purchased and also on purchasing low cost goods. Generally people will show less involvement in frequently buying products.

<u>Extensive Decision Making </u>occurs while purchasing the expensive product. These products are unfamiliar and are not bought frequently. So their involvement level will be high.
